I got started in social media when one of my friends low-key forced me to get an Instagram. It started off just being a personal Instagram.

My favorite people to follow were my friends and family, hands down. Even today I’m always looking online and seeing all the new things in their lives. It keeps me updated, because I don’t get to see all of them very often. I love my family so, so, so much, and would do anything for them, but, because I’m super competitive, and I believed as a kid your follower count equaled how cool you were, I started trying to get more followers than my friends.

In 2016 I started getting serious about things, and really started thinking, “What if I really tried to do social media and make it work for me?” Social media has kinda given me a passion in life for modeling, and making people happy, and making them smile. It has given me a purpose and a dream to pursue.

My biggest dream is to be able one day to support my family. To give my family and friends any, and every, opportunity. I love putting smiles on peoples faces, and giving to others. That’s my ultimate goal — to help my loved ones, and to help people in need.
I also want to inspire others. Now I’m here traveling, modeling, and doing things I never thought I’d do. Social media has helped me find my passion, and has shaped who I am, and who I want to become. It has helped me go from a quiet small little kid, to who I am today, changing my whole life and making me a better person entirely.
